This is the CBSE Class 12 Psychology (Theory) 2019 Main Exam Delhi Set-1 Previous Year Question Paper. The paper is divided into five parts: Part A (10 questions, 1 mark each), Part B (6 questions, 2 marks each), Part C (4 questions, 3 marks each), Part D (6 questions, 4 marks each), and Part E (2 questions, 6 marks each). The total marks for the paper are 70, and students are allotted 3 hours to complete it. This board question paper includes general instructions regarding answer length and format for each section. General Instructions:
- All questions are compulsory.
- Marks for each question are indicated against it.
- Answers should be brief and to the point.
- Questions no. 1 - 10 in Part A has Learning Checks (very short answer type) questions carrying 1 mark each. You are required to answer them as directed.
- Questions no. 11 - 16 in Part B are Very Short Answer type questions carrying 2 marks each. Answer to each question should not exceed 30 words.
- Questions no. 17 - 20 in Part C are Short Answer Type-I questions carrying 3 marks each. Answer to each question should not exceed 60 words.
- Questions no. 21 - 26 in Part D are Short Answer Type-II questions carrying 4 marks each. Answer to each question should not exceed 100 words.
- Questions no. 27 and 28 in Part E are Long Answer Type questions carrying 6 marks each. Answer to each question should not exceed 200 words.
